DOCUMENT:Q141246 10-JUN-2000 [powerpt] TITLE :PPT7: Group Command Unavailable When Placeholder Object Selected PRODUCT :Microsoft PowerPoint for Windows PROD/VER:WINDOWS:7.0 OPER/SYS: KEYWORDS:kbusage ====================================================================== ------------------------------------------------------------------------------- The information in this article applies to: - Microsoft PowerPoint for Windows 95, version 7.0 ------------------------------------------------------------------------------- SYMPTOMS ======== If you select several objects on a slide and your selection includes the Title object and/or the Body Text object, the Group command on the Draw menu (on the Drawing toolbar) is unavailable (dimmed). RESOLUTION ========== If you want to make a group that includes the Title or Body Text objects, copy all the existing objects on the slide to a new slide using the blank AutoLayout and then you can group them. 1. On the Edit menu, click Select All. 2. On the Edit menu, click Copy. 3. On the Edit menu, click New Slide. 4. In the New Slide dialog box, choose the Blank AutoLayout. 5. On the Edit menu, click Paste Special, then click Objects. You can now select any combination of the objects on this slide and group them together. NOTE: Empty Title and Body Text placeholders cannot be grouped together or grouped with other objects, even when copied to a new blank slide.
